What is a 1 3/8" OD Pipe Flange?
A 1 3/8" OD pipe flange is a circular metal disc used to connect pipes, valves, and other equipment in a piping system. The "OD" refers to the outside diameter of the pipe the flange is designed to fit. The flange provides a surface for bolting components together, creating a sealed connection. What are the Different Types of 1 3/8" OD Pipe Flanges?
Several types of 1 3/8" OD flanges cater to various applications and pressure requirements. Some common types include:
-
Weld Neck Flanges: These flanges are welded directly to the pipe, offering high strength and resistance to high pressures and temperatures. They are ideal for critical applications.
-
Slip-On Flanges: These flanges slip over the pipe end and are then welded to the pipe. They're easier to install than weld neck flanges but offer slightly lower pressure ratings.
-
Socket Weld Flanges: Designed for smaller diameter pipes, these flanges are inserted into the pipe and welded. Suitable for low-pressure applications where a strong, reliable weld is needed.
-
Threaded Flanges: These flanges feature threaded bores that screw onto the pipe, offering easy installation and removal. However, they generally have lower pressure ratings than welded flanges.
-
Blind Flanges: These are solid, flat flanges used to cap off the end of a pipe. They are essential for isolating sections of the piping system during maintenance or repairs.
The choice of flange type depends on factors like pressure, temperature, the type of pipe material, and the specific application.
What Materials are 1 3/8" OD Pipe Flanges Made Of?
The material of a 1 3/8" OD flange is crucial for its performance and durability. Common materials include:
-
Carbon Steel: A cost-effective choice for many applications, offering good strength and weldability.
-
Stainless Steel: Provides superior corrosion resistance, making it suitable for harsh environments and applications handling corrosive fluids.
-
Ductile Iron: Offers high strength and excellent corrosion resistance, often used in water and wastewater systems.

How Do I Choose the Right 1 3/8" OD Pipe Flange?
Selecting the correct 1 3/8" OD pipe flange requires careful consideration of:
- Pipe Material and Schedule: Ensure the flange is compatible with the pipe material and schedule (wall thickness).
- Pressure and Temperature Requirements: Choose a flange with a pressure rating exceeding the expected operating conditions.
- Application: Select a flange type appropriate for the specific application and installation method.
- Industry Standards: Verify that the flange meets relevant industry standards and regulations.
